      Adams Gets London Chess Classic Wild Card

      Chess Admin Posted onAugust 25, 2016August 25, 2016 London Chess Classic 1 Comment 5 Views

      The 10th and last player to join the line-up of the 8th London Chess Classic is none other than England’s number one, Michael Adams. The Cornishman has been the country’s leading player since 1999 and was once ranked number...

      Dates for London Chess Classic Set

      Chess Admin Posted onFebruary 24, 2016February 24, 2016 Grand Chess Tour, London, London Chess Classic Leave a Comment 3 Views

      The 2016 London Chess Classic will be the eighth edition of the World’s most prestigious Chess Tournament and will climax the 2016 Grand Chess Tour. The winning formula of elite 10 player all play all, chess festival, conference and...
